Business Sales (Coming soon)

Start date: 7th September 2026

£32,000 per annum|2 years

About this programme

Sky is launching an exciting new graduate programme within Sky Business Sales — a fast-growing area focused on delivering broadband, mobile, TV, and sports packages to businesses like hotels, pubs, and other commercial venues. This is a unique opportunity to be part of a brand-new initiative, shaped by industry leaders and designed to give you hands-on experience in business-to-business (B2B) sales.

You’ll be joining a small, tight-knit cohort of graduates who will help shape the future of Sky Business. With structured training, real client interactions, and rotational placements across different sales functions, this programme is ideal for ambitious graduates who want to build a career in commercial sales and strategy.

What you’ll be doing

You’ll start the programme with a six-month placement in Leeds, where you’ll build your knowledge and get hands-on experience. After that, you’ll move to a new location based on business needs and your preferences — with possible placements in Manchester, London, or other UK cities.

During the two-year programme, you’ll gain a deep understanding of how Sky Business operates and how we deliver value to our clients. Your journey will include:

  • Initial 6-month placement in Leeds:

    • Desk-based learning and onboarding
    • Internal training delivered by Sky Business experts
    • Handling small client accounts and learning the fundamentals of Business to Business (B2B) sales
  • Rotational placements across different sales functions, such as:

    • Wholesale Sales
    • Direct Sales
    • Account Management
    • Customer Retention and Acquisition

This graduate programme offers a strong foundation in both commercial strategy and client-facing sales. You’ll gain insight into key business areas such as business strategy, data analytics, and commercial decision-making, while also developing hands-on experience working directly with clients — building relationships, understanding their needs, tailoring solutions, and supporting sales growth and customer retention. By the end of the programme, you’ll have a well-rounded understanding of how Sky Business operates and the confidence to make a real impact.

What we’re looking for

This programme is open to graduates from any degree discipline — so whether you studied business, history, engineering, or something completely different, we want to hear from you. What matters most is your mindset, motivation, and willingness to learn. Curious and eager to learn – You enjoy exploring new ideas and asking questions to understand how things work.

  • People-focused – You’re great at building relationships, listening to others, and working as part of a team.
  • Confident communicators – You can express yourself clearly, whether that’s in person, over the phone, or in writing.
  • Problem solvers – You like figuring things out and coming up with smart, practical solutions.
  • Open to new experiences – You’re happy to move to a new city, meet new people, and try new things.
  • Motivated and proactive – You take initiative, get involved, and look for ways to make a difference.

You don’t need to have studied sales or have previous experience in the field — we’ll give you all the training and support you need. If you’re excited by the idea of working in a fast-paced, client-focused environment and want to build a career in business-to-business sales and strategy, this could be the perfect fit.

Right to work: You must have the appropriate right to work in the UK by the programme's start date. Please be aware Sky does not offer sponsorship for this programme.
